Bleach 257: Heinz Baked Beans

Bleach episode 257 review

More music, more music, more music, more music…

A new enemy has appeared, called “Sword Beasts.” Rukia spends all day talking with her Zanpakuto, and not really doing all that much. Rangiku shows up to Urahara Shop with Haineko, then joins Orihime as they go after the enemy. A new building is being built, one that eerily resembles the U.S. Steel Tower in my hometown, all the way down to the shape of the building, and the red lights on top of it. In any case, there’s a Sword Beast up on the scaffolding, and when Rangiku proves too useless to defeat it, Ichigo shows up to fight it.

Overall, a good episode with some antics between Nanao and Mayuri (!) which further shows the dysfunction within the Seireitei which explains why they are so keen to betrayals. It’s enough for me to hand the “best girl” title to Nanao, even though Rangiku got more screen time.

Best girl of the episode: Nanao (4) (moving into a tie with Nemu and Mizuho for 12th place)

Episode rating: 7/10
